Statuette of Osiris with the name of Padihorpere, Late Period, Dynasty 25–26, ca. 712–525 B.C., From Egypt, Copper alloy, H. 29 × W. 6.2 × D. 4.2 cm (11 7/16 × 2 7/16 × 1 5/8 in.), A superb example of a bronze, this figure of Osiris is shown in his typical mummy form, wearing his tall plumed crown and holding the crook and flail of kingship. These elements were overlaid with gold, as was his face, neck, curled beard of divinity, broad festival collar, and pectoral, the latter of which bears an image of the solar bark
